Output 14483607b18fc6aefdc216c283abef7680f624c9fd3bfe8ca79dceaf50b519ea:1

value
2871860
script pubkey
OP_0 OP_PUSHBYTES_20 1acfa94f856e542a3e376ebf0e09df7e1e44a17b
address
ltc1qrt86jnu9de2z503hd6lsuzwl0c0yfgtmhmcnr7
transaction
14483607b18fc6aefdc216c283abef7680f624c9fd3bfe8ca79dceaf50b519ea
spent
true